Terry Steinbach was a professional baseball C/DH who played from 1986 to 1999. During his career, Steinbach appeared in 1546 games, recording 1453 hits with a 0.271 average. A right-handed, Steinbach stood 6'1" tall and brought athleticism and dedication to his position. Born in New Ulm, MN, Steinbach made significant contributions to baseball.
